Zwitterion - amino acids are the most common form of zwitterions. it basically means that the ion has two charged atoms that cancel each other out. Just look up zwitterion on wikipedia

What do we call the amino acids your body cant make and how can we get these amino acids in our diet?

We call the amino acids that the body can't make essential amino acids. We can get essential amino acids in our diet by consuming protein-rich foods such as meat, poultry, fish, eggs, dairy products, legumes, nuts, and seeds.

What are the advantages to ionization of amino acids?

Ionization of amino acids can increase their solubility in water, enhance their reactivity in chemical reactions, and enable them to interact with other charged molecules in biological systems. This ionization can also influence the overall structure and function of proteins and peptides in the body.

Which ion is part of every amino acid?

Amino acids all contain an amino group (-NH2) and a carboxyl group (-COOH), which form an ionized form known as a zwitterion. This means that in an aqueous solution, amino acids exist as both a cation (NH3+) and an anion (COO-).
